What qualifications do you need to get into cyber security?

What qualifications do you need to get into cyber security?

If you’re interested in a cyber security career, one of the following degree subjects will help you along the career path:

  • IT.
  • Cyber security.
  • Computer science.
  • Forensic computing.
  • Network engineering.
  • Networks and security.
  • Mathematics, physics or other STEM subjects.

Can I get into cybersecurity without a degree?

“If not having a degree has held you back from pursuing a career in technology, you should know that most tech positions simply require proof that you can do the job, through certifications and prior experience. So yes, you can get an entry-level job in cybersecurity without a degree.

Can I start a career in cyber security with no experience?

Although it will help, it’s not required to have previous experience in the field to qualify for an entry-level junior cybersecurity position. You just need to focus on the training courses below and have the right mindset to move forward in a career in cybersecurity.

Is a cyber security degree hard?

Cyber security degrees tend to be more challenging than non-research type majors, such as programs in the humanities or business, but are usually not as difficult as degrees in research or lab intensive areas, such as science and engineering.

Is Cyber Security hard to get into?

It is not hard to get a job in cybersecurity. The number of positions is growing with the Bureau of Labor Statistics expecting the field to increase more than 30\% over the next ten years. Most hiring managers emphasize soft skills for entry-level candidates with most of the technical skills learned on the job.
